Understanding WPC Decking

To evaluate the efficacy of WPC decking, it is crucial to understand its composition and how it differs from conventional decking materials. WPC is a composite material made by blending wood fibers or wood flour with thermoplastics such as polyethylene, polypropylene, or polyvinyl chloride. Additives like pigments, lubricants, and binding agents are often included to enhance the material's properties. The result is a material that mimics the appearance of wood while offering enhanced durability and reduced maintenance needs.

Composition and Manufacturing Process

The manufacturing of WPC involves a process called extrusion, where the mixed raw materials are heated and shaped into decking boards. The proportion of wood to plastic can vary, but typically ranges from 30% to 70% wood content. Higher wood content can enhance the natural look but may affect durability, while higher plastic content tends to improve resistance to moisture and decay. Comparison with Traditional Wood Decking

Traditional wood decking, often made from cedar, redwood, or treated lumber, has been a staple in residential and commercial projects. While wood offers a classic appearance, it is susceptible to rot, insect infestation, and requires regular maintenance such as staining or sealing. In contrast, WPC decking is designed to resist these common issues. Studies have shown that WPC decking can last longer than traditional wood, with less need for maintenance, potentially offsetting the higher initial cost over time.

Durability and Low Maintenance

One of the primary advantages of WPC decking is its superior durability. The plastic components provide resistance to moisture, rot, and insects, common pitfalls of natural wood. WPC decking does not warp, crack, or splinter, even when exposed to harsh weather conditions. According to industry data, WPC decks can have a lifespan of 25-30 years with minimal maintenance. Unlike wood, which requires periodic staining or sealing, WPC decking typically only needs regular cleaning with soap and water to maintain its appearance.

Environmental Benefits

Environmental sustainability is a significant consideration in today’s construction industry. WPC decking often incorporates recycled materials, both wood waste and plastic, reducing landfill burden. By utilizing recycled plastics, WPC decking contributes to a reduction in environmental pollution. Additionally, the use of wood fibers from industrial by-products minimizes the need for virgin timber, helping to preserve forests and biodiversity. Cost Considerations

The initial cost of WPC decking is generally higher than that of traditional wood decking. This higher price point can be a barrier for some consumers. However, when factoring in the reduced maintenance costs and longer lifespan, the total cost of ownership over time may be comparable or even favorable. Economic analyses have indicated that, over a 20-year period, homeowners can save up to 30% in maintenance expenses by choosing WPC decking over wood.

Aesthetic Differences

Despite advances in manufacturing, some critics argue that WPC decking lacks the natural warmth and character of real wood. The uniformity of WPC boards may not appeal to those seeking the unique grain patterns and color variations found in natural timber. However, recent developments have led to more realistic textures and colors in WPC products, expanding the aesthetic options available to consumers.

Residential Use

For homeowners, WPC decking offers a low-maintenance solution for outdoor living spaces. Its resistance to moisture makes it ideal for pool decks and areas exposed to the elements. Additionally, the slip-resistant surface provides safety for families with children or elderly members. Customized designs and a range of color options enable homeowners to create personalized spaces without sacrificing durability.

Commercial and Public Projects

In commercial settings, the long-term cost savings and durability of WPC decking are significant advantages. Municipal projects, such as waterfront promenades or park walkways, benefit from WPC's ability to withstand heavy foot traffic and harsh environmental conditions. The material's low maintenance requirements reduce the operational costs associated with upkeep and repairs over time.
